Nasinu Secondary School Under 18 rugby side will be banking on experience for their Coke Zero Deans quarterfinals clash against Western giants Ratu Navula College this Saturday.

Last year Nasinu lost to Queen Victoria School 31-21 in the final and they still have eight players who were part of that squad.

Nasinu team Manager Marika Sovaki said these players need to pave the way against Ratu Navula.


Meanwhile, Ratu Navula College has lost seven players from their victorious Under 17 side last year to overseas scholarships.

The current Under 18 side is the school’s dream team as they have won the national titles from the Under 15 grade in 2010.

Ratu Navula College will face Nasinu Secondary School this Saturday at the ANZ Stadium and you can catch the live commentary on our sister station VITI FM plus the second half of the Assemblies of God and Navuso Methodist High School match.
 
Meanwhile, in the other Under 18 quarterfinals QVS will meet Saint John’s College and RKS face John Wesley College.
